As advertised, great quality unit with no corners cut!
When you want a quality power supply, Seasonic should be one of your first stops.The good Corsair, NZXT, Fractal, and many other brands are often Seasonic units in disguise (Please note if you own multiple units: sometimes with a different modular cable socket pattern - please keep this in mind as other brands may or may not be electrically compatible with cables not made by the same manufacturer! Units manufactured by Seasonic in the last half-dozen years as far as I know all have the same cabling socket patterns on the modular plugs on the back of the power supply, provided they're sold as a Seasonic and not as another brand).I had a Focus Gold 620 that was almost - but not quite enough - for my workstation here, and as I upgraded it became more and more obvious that I was really pushing the poor thing to the cliff's edge. It never failed, but being modular when I ordered this MONSTER supply, I could just switch the brick itself and be fine (I switched the PCI, CPU, and motherboard cables when I did as they're thicker gauge wire on this better unit vs the 620, be mindful of wire gage when hooking up cables, try and keep the same unit's cables together so you don't mix them up and end up with hot wires or worse).Sorry if this is a disorganized mess of a review, but I hope some of the info is helpful to folks (If it is please mark it as so, if you have a comment or something helpful also feel free to add it in to help others).Seriously, if you want excellence, get this unit, or get a Corsair AX1000~AX1600 unit which is also made by Seasonic (but uses different cables!), or the Fractal units if you don't need one as big wattage.You can't go wrong with these. You *CAN* do one better by going platinum, which is one or two steps up in quality and perfection and two more years of warranty (this is 10, that is 12). However, it's been shown that buying into Platinum units is not worth the extra cost if it's beyond twenty dollars USD as you will no longer recoup the savings. Plus if you get a bigger gold unit, vs a platinum unit that's smaller, your efficiency will be very similar as you'll run closer to the middle output of the unit, if the bigger unit is pushed near 90~100% capacity it will then be notably less efficient than platinum.Best part about buying Seasonic units if you have a few computers, especially if from the same product family, you'll always have cables handy, and if the unlikely event one gives up the ghost and dies, you can just replace the brick itself.Seasonic warranty is also second to none.
